The moon phase on February 16, 1936 was Last Quarter.
The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on February 16, 1936 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.
An observer located in New York City on February 16, 1936 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 30% full, rising at 01:49 am and setting at 11:57 am.
The previous full moon was on Feb 07, 1936 while the next full moon would come on Mar 08, 1936.

On February 16, 1936 the US President was Franklin D. Roosevelt (Democrat).
On February 16, 1936 the UK Prime Minister was Stanley Baldwin (Conservative).
On February 16, 1936 the Pope was Pius XI.
